I'm about at the end of my printer ribbon....
I've been trying to get my trusty HP 932C to work with my recently installed
XP machine. There are no printer drivers on it, the device manager doesn't
show any problems but when I try to install the software downloaded from HP,
it stops midway and says it can't find a setup file in the HP software. What
gives?

I don't know about the downloaded software, but Windows XP has a native
HP932c printer driver included.

Try installing the basic driver, then go to Windows Update and see if
there is an updated driver available.

I don't know if this is your answer. Disconnect the printer, THEN try to
install the drivers. Then reconnect the printer after shut down.
Everything HP that I've ever bought had to install this way.

Worth a try. Hope it helps....
